[ 'ɪnt(ə)rɪm ]
■ noun ( the ~ ) the intervening time.
■ adjective
1》 provisional.
2》 relating to less than a full year's business activity: ~ profits.
■ adverb archaic meanwhile.
Origin
C16: from L., 'meanwhile'.
